Donald Joe Cole

November 16, 1932 — May 21, 2015

Donald Joe Cole, 82, of Lakewood, Colorado, passed away at home on May 21, 2015. Joe was born November 16, 1932 in Laramie, WY. He was a devoted husband to his loving wife of 61 years, Donna Elizabeth Gabrielson Cole, and a proud father to his daughters Suzanne Elizabeth Cole-Rice (Robert Rice) and Jennifer Jo Cole (William Maguire). He is also survived by his sister Glenna Jean Powell and numerous nieces, nephews, grand-nieces and grand-nephews. Joe graduated from the University of Wyoming Preparatory School and the University of Wyoming (1954) with a degree in Industrial Arts Education. He received his commission as a Second Lieutenant in the US Army Ordnance Corp upon graduation and entered service in September that year. He retired from the Army in 1976 with the rank of Lieutenant Colonel. He was a Vietnam Veteran and he served in New Dehli, India at the US Embassy. He took his family to his posts in France and Germany, as well as numerous stateside locations. Joe's hobbies included fine woodworking, gardening, landscaping, reading mysteries and suspense novels, and planning his and Donna's many trips including attendance at about 35 Elderhostels. He was a life member of the Veterans of Foreign Wars and a Founding Sponsor of the National Museum of the US Army. He belonged to the University of Wyoming Alumni Association and the Military Officers Association of America. In past years, he was a trail maintenance volunteer for Jefferson County Open Space, an active square dancer, and a huge supporter of his daughters' many activities. He enjoyed camping, hunting, and fishing. Services and burial of ashes will be held in Laramie, Wyoming this summer.
